Not sure if I agree with that.

Several bowlers have been reported for suspect action while playing in the IPL. Interestingly enough, Narine himself was reported for suspect action whilst playing in the IPL in 2020.

There is no evidence that it is easier to get away with chucking in IPL and even if it is, it clearly does not apply to Narine because, as mentioned above, he was reported in IPL in 2020.

He is one of many WI players who have given preference to franchise cricket over international cricket.

There is no reason to associate his international retirement with his bowling action especially because it is based on conjecture and not any evidence.

This theory would have had legs and I would have bought it if there wasn’t a significant list of bowlers getting reported in the IPL including Narine himself.
